Happy New Year, Release Date, Cast, Spoilers and more News: Bollywood Film to bring Cheer to People
Happy New Year movie is one of Bollywood's latest creation which hopes to bring people joy when they watch it during Diwali. The movie stars Shah Rukh Khan who is known for doing multiple film projects at the same time. According to him, this is, so that he can enjoy more of the filmmaking process, in which in Happy New Year 2014 movie, he was fortunate enough to do so.
Happy New Year movie budget was counted as one of the big budget Bollywood films. It took one hundred and seventy days to shoot the entire movie. So how do the production expect to bring in some joy, well, it's not Bollywood without Happy New Year movie songs to accompany the great storyline. It will surely have us on a feel-good mood while watching the movie.
Because fans will arguably sing-a-long with the songs in the movie, Happy New Year movie song downloads will surely hit it off.
Happy New Year movie is produced by Red Chillies Entertainments, Shah Rukh Khan's company and is directed by one of his good friend Farah Khan. This is the third movie wherein the two had worked together, which makes it easier as they know how each other mind ticks.
